[QUOTE="Muse_Cubed, post: 1000154, member: 12841"] Without turning this post into a pages of rant, Madden has become so shockingly poor. Gameplay-wise it's worse than Madden 08, and much much worse than 2K's All Pro Football 2k8. I mean, the games look good mostly, but they've stripped out all the depth from franchise mode and replaced it with loot boxes. The same problems from Madden 08 are STILL THERE (blocking logic and defensive positioning being the worst, compensated for by suck-in animations), they stripped out all the of the physics elements, and they keep taking features out and adding them back in 5 years later so they can market this "AWSUM NEW FEATURE" before dropping it the next year. I hear FIFA's kinda similar but don't have first hand experience. BTW this isn't hyperbole and I rarely experience nostalgia. I'd be annoyed if Madden had done the bare minimum in adding new features each year, but they've subtracted far more from the football simulation world than they've added in the last 10 years and it's such a cynical approach to making games. I don't expect a return to the golden years of sports gaming (basically the 2000s up until the financial crash), but I do appreciate when teams genuinely try to improve their games year on year, despite budgets or team size. And yeah, Rugby is a hard game to recreate well, especially when the ideal (at least in my head) would be heavily physics based gameplay and pretty complex player behaviour. Not impossible but yeah, it'd be a labour of love and require patience. And cash. [/QUOTE]
